Abstract

Inventia se refera la un inel format din pulberi metalice sinterizate pe baza de ter, avînd pulbere de cupru între 2...10%, pulbere de grafit între 0,1 si 10% si restul fier, materialul rezultat avînd o porozitate între 20 si 30% determinata de introducerea în mare pulberi, în timpul operatiei de amestecare, a unei cantitati între 0,1 si 5,5% stearat de zinc. Inelul prezinta rezistenta sporita la uzura datorita frecarii cursorului si la actiunea agresiva datorita aciditatii baii de tratare în timpul filarii, reducînd utilizarea pulberii de otel inoxidabil.The invention relates to a ring formed from terra-based sintered metallic powders having a copper powder of between 2 and 10%, a graphite powder between 0.1 and 10% and the remainder iron, the resulting material having a porosity of between 20 and 30% due to the high particulate injection during the mixing operation of an amount of between 0.1 and 5.5% of zinc stearate. The ring has increased wear resistance due to friction and aggressive action due to the acidity of the treatment bath during filing, reducing the use of stainless steel powder.
